Transaction e03cac391b0b3753780517fdb3db11eb2b625cdc5532daf27e5035ee95760ad9
1 Input
1 Output
-
e03cac391b0b3753780517fdb3db11eb2b625cdc5532daf27e5035ee95760ad9:0
- value
- 197167043
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d430a85405f2ea6c6a31ef21ca2a308185bf256 OP_EQUAL
- address
- MLn5paKUAss51BJ6HRcCt66r43cU7nhp1F